My first build and it came out better than I wanted to so thought I'd enter it for GoM.
It started as a base ST kit, sanded, sealed and primed. Black acrylic base coat applied to the neck and body. Light white base coat over the black and while still wet layered cling wrap onto the wet paint. After a few seconds pulled off the cling wrap to leave a marbled finish.
Next came a light black airbrushed sunburst around the body, neck and headstock followed by 5 coats of Port Red candy (5% concentrate mixed with acrylic clear ). After the candy came 5 coats of clearcoat. Sanded back to a flat surface and then bought back to a deep shine with cutting compound and auto polish.
Finished it off with some chrome covers, knobs and switches.
Two months work on and off, but well worth the time
